Re: incremental rebuilds in Thistledown — overall this looks solid, nice work trimming the dependency graph walk. One thing for the sync: the debounce window you picked feels aggressive, and combined with the new per-page hash cache it could starve rarely-edited sections of rebuilds for hours. Maybe fine? But let's at least surface the knobs so we can argue with data instead of vibes. I pulled the current defaults out of the config module so everyone can see them.

tuning table, yajog-yahof:
BUDGETS = {
    "lamvan": 303,
    "wenox": 460,
    "fenvan": 525,
}

ALERT: Sweepling, the orphaned-resource sweeper on the Quarrystone platform, has skipped three consecutive runs. Untagged volumes and detached load balancers are accumulating in the Fennwick region. Check the sweeper's lease lock first; a stale lease from a crashed pod is the usual culprit. If the lock is clean, inspect the reaper queue depth. Escalate to the Groundskeeping team if unresolved within one hour.

escalation mailbox, hahif-bagag: kasix_praok_ulaath@halixforge.test

**Ticket: Trace context dropped between Orderly and Shipmate services**

Spans from the Orderly gateway are not propagating to the Shipmate fulfillment service, leaving orphaned traces in the Lanternview dashboard. The propagation header appears to be stripped by the retry middleware. Reviewer: please check the header allowlist change in the proxy layer. The failing behavior reproduces consistently on the build recorded below.

pipeline stamp: htk31_f769b577b3028a4e9958e5bb8d1259a

## Step 4 — String Extraction (Lumenfall release)

Run the extractor before cutting the locale branch. It scans `src/ui` and dumps new keys to `locales/pending.json`. Do not hand-edit that file; translators pull from it directly.

If the script flags duplicate keys, fix the source, not the output. Re-run until clean.

Commit the result, then tag the build. The tag must be signed with the release key, shown below.

signing key of bagap-yawep = bky13_TbfT6ZMUoGJo2

Liftgrid Simulator — Stuck Dispatch Queue. If simulated cars stop accepting hall calls, check the dispatch worker heap first; a full heap silently drops calls rather than erroring. Restart the worker with the drain flag, then replay the last scenario file to confirm queue movement. Log the incident with the trace token shown below.

trace token, hahaf-tahof: htk6_c05966